An Engagement Letter is a legal document that defines the relationship between a professional (such as a lawyer, accountant, or consultant) and their client. It outlines the services to be provided, the terms of the agreement, and any other obligations or expectations.

An engagement contract, sometimes called an engagement letter, is a formal legal declaration of intent to do business or ""engage"" with another party. This agreement is typical in attorney, contractor, and financial advisor relationships with clients.

An engagement letter is a written agreement that describes the business relationship to be entered into by a client and a company. The letter details the scope of the agreement, its terms, and costs. The purpose of an engagement letter is to set expectations on both sides of the agreement.

An engagement letter is drafted by the company rendering the service, often with the help of a lawyer. It is than presented to the client, and both parties must sign in order for it to be legally binding.

How to write an engagement letter Write the name of the business leader. Specify the purpose of the partnership. List the duties of the client. Identify the timeline for completing the project. Include resources the client delivers. Attach a disclaimer. Validate the terms of the agreement.

The service provider typically prepares the Letter of Engagement, be it a law firm, accounting agency, consultancy, or any professional offering services.

An engagement letter is generally specific to professional services, such as accounting, consulting, or legal services. A contract, on the other hand, is a broader term that can apply to any agreement involving two parties, irrespective of the nature of their engagement.
